BASIC QUALIFICATIONS:

  •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science, Information Technology, or related field.
  • 9+ years of hands-on experience with Java, J2EE, Springboot, React, HTML/CSS/Javascript; Python and Angular are beneficial.
  • 2+ years of leadership experience in guiding and developing teams to drive successful project outcomes.
  • Strong knowledge of databases, integration architectures, and data modeling.
  • Proficiency in API best practices, application servers, cloud services (AWS), and secure development.

PREFERRED QUALIFICATIONS:

  • Experience with GenAI/LLM models and prompt engineering.
  • Familiarity with single sign-on integrations (IDP, SP initiated, SAML, OAuth/OpenID).
  • Prior experience with SCRUM/Agile methodologies and enterprise-level application development.
  • Excellent communication skills for authoring technical documents and presenting designs.

Responsibilities

RESPONSIBILITIES AND IMPACT:

As a Technical Lead, you will play a crucial role in designing, implementing, and optimizing internal content platforms. Your contributions will directly impact the Commodity Insights business by enhancing the speed and efficiency, leading to faster decision-making for our clients and a competitive edge in the market.

  • Collaborate with product owners and cross-functional teams to understand business requirements, develop solution options, and ensure successful implementation.
  • Design and optimize content platforms, enhancing speed and efficiency to support faster decision-making for clients.
  • Lead technical projects and mentor developers in an agile environment, adopting new technologies and ensuring deliverables are met.
  • Implement DevOps practices, including Continuous Integration and Continuous Delivery, while ensuring security compliance.
  • Conduct impact analyses for functional and technical changes, coordinating with shared service teams.
  • Create Proof of Concepts (POCs) and provide technical recommendations backed by evidence.
